Analysis
The most recent figure for gross fixed capital formation, general government, constant prices in Guinea is -32.04 % change on previous year, measured in 2019.
Compared with earlier readings it is up 41.3% on the previous year and down 104.9% over ten years.
Over the whole period, gross fixed capital formation, general government, constant prices in Guinea peaked at 657.26 % change on previous year in 2009 and was at its lowest, -57.26 % change on previous year, in 2016.
Guinea ranks 162nd of 173 countries on this measure, in the bottom quarter.
The series is highly variable year to year, so single readings are best treated with caution.

How this figure is calculated
The year-on-year percentage change in Gross fixed capital formation, General government, Constant prices, Purchasing power parity (PPP) international dollar, ICP benchmark 2017. Computed from consecutive annual observations; years either side of a gap are skipped rather than bridged.
Computed from
- Gross fixed capital formation, General government, Constant prices International Monetary Fund
Statizoid computes this series; the underlying measurements belong to the publishers named above. The arithmetic is applied to every country and year where both inputs report, and nothing is estimated unless the page says so.
